Obituary

Ray O. Oaks, 72, of Peru passed away at 9:33 p.m., Friday, August 26, 2022 at Wesleyan Health

and Rehabilitation Center in Marion.  Born on August 2, 1950 in Peru, he was the son of the late

Norman Oaks and Martha Sutton Oaks. 

Ray was a United States Marine Veteran and a recipient of a Purple Heart. He also retired from Chrysler as an assembly worker.

Survivors include his wife, Sharon Oaks, son, Paul (Susan) Oaks, step son, John Fincher, daughters, Jessica Scherer, Stephanie (Tim) Warnock, brothers, Alan (Jennifer), Don, Danny, sisters, Rita Schelonk, 14 grandchildren and 3 great grandchildren.

He was preceded in death by his brothers, Roy, Carl, Gary, and sister, June Stark.

Celebration of Life will be held at 1:00 p.m. on Tuesday, September 6, 2022, at Riverview Funeral Home at 1:00 p.m., Visitation will be from 12:00 p.m. to 1:00 p.m.

Burial with Military Rites will follow at Mt. Hope Cemetery in Peru.
